    i'm a licensed cosmetologist during the day and we learn about skin as part of the schooling.

    you should always exfoliate before applying lotion. removing the dead cells makes a huge difference in how the lotion's absorbed. trader joes has some great scrubs w/oil in them. use these, then apply lotion for daytime or before bed at night, a body butter (they have some great ones at body shop).

    moisturize internally as well, that makes a huge difference (even moreso than the outside care). take some omega oil pills, coconut oil (i do both) or flaxseeds or a couple tablespoons of extra virgin olive oil per day. yes, it's yucky alone, close nose, big swallow and it's over.

    also drink lots of water and reducing your consumption of caffeinated beverages, colas, coffee and tea helps a lot.
